Registration & Verification – First Steps Before You Can Withdraw
Signing up at Playamo takes under two minutes. You’ll need a valid email address, a password, and a chosen username. After confirming the activation link, the real work begins: the KYC (Know Your Customer) verification. This step is mandatory before any withdrawal is processed and is a common hurdle for many new players.
The documents requested are typical – a government‑issued ID (driver’s licence or passport), a recent utility bill or bank statement for address proof, and occasionally a proof of payment for the first deposit. Upload them through the “Verification” tab in your account dashboard; the team usually replies within 24‑48 hours. If you keep all files clear and legible, you’ll avoid the dreaded “pending verification” status that stalls withdrawals.

Step‑by‑Step Playamo Review Withdrawal Process
When your balance is ready, head to the “Cashier” page and pick “Withdraw”. You’ll see a list of eligible methods – usually the same as your deposit route, but some e‑wallets allow faster processing.
Follow this checklist:
- Enter the withdrawal amount (must meet any wagering requirements).
- Select your preferred payment method.
- Confirm the transaction with your two‑factor authentication code.
- Submit the request and wait for the status to change from “Pending” to “Processing”.
If your account isn’t fully verified, the system will prompt you to upload the missing documents before the request can move forward. Once approved, the funds will be dispatched according to the method’s schedule.
Withdrawal Speed & Limits – What Aussies Can Expect
Playamo advertises “instant payouts” for e‑wallets, and that claim holds up in most user reports. Skrill and Neteller withdrawals usually land in your wallet within 15‑30 minutes after approval. Credit‑card refunds, on the other hand, can take 2‑5 business days, while bank transfers stretch to 3‑7 days.
There are also limits to keep in mind:
- Maximum daily withdrawal: A$5,000
- Minimum withdrawal amount: A$20
- Weekly cumulative limit for new players: A$2,000
High‑roller Aussies who plan to move large sums should contact support beforehand to arrange a higher limit; the team is generally accommodating if you’ve built a solid play history.

Customer Support & Responsible Gambling Measures
Playamo provides 24/7 live chat and email support. The live chat is the fastest route for withdrawal queries – agents typically respond within a minute and can give real‑time updates on the status of your request. For more complex issues (e.g., disputed transactions), email tickets are the norm and may take up to 48 hours.
On the responsible gambling front, the casino offers self‑exclusion tools, deposit limits, and a “cool‑off” period. These features are accessible from the account settings and are advisable if you notice your playing habits getting out of hand.
